Warning Sign Requirements
Posting safety alerts can reduce liability—but only if they’re adequate. A small, faded sign won’t protect a property owner from a trip and fall accident. The warning must reflect the danger and be placed in advance. Even with signs, owners must still address the issue within a appropriate timeframe to avoid claims of negligent maintenance.

Deadline to Submit a Personal Injury Claim in East Point?
The Georgia claim cutoff is commonly a two-year window from the incident date. However, missing deadlines can eliminate recovery options, so it’s essential to contact a personal injury law firm East Point immediately.
What Happens If I Contributed to a Property Injury?
Absolutely, thanks to Georgia comparative negligence, you may receive financial recovery even if you were moderately negligent. However, your settlement amount will be diminished by your degree of negligence, which is why strong evidence and courtroom advocacy are vital.
